Intel Core i9-12900KS - Benchmark, Test and Specs


Intel Core i9-12900KS

The processor Intel Core i9-12900KS is developed on the 10 nm technology node and architecture Alder Lake S. Its base clock speed is 3.40 GHz (5.50 GHz), and maximum clock speed in turbo boost - 2.50 GHz (4.00 GHz). Intel Core i9-12900KS contains 16 processing cores. Blender 2.81 (bmw27)

Blender is a free 3D graphics software for rendering (creating) 3D bodies, which can also be textured and animated in the software. The Blender benchmark creates predefined scenes and measures the time (s) required for the entire scene. The shorter the time required, the better. We selected bmw27 as the benchmark scene.
